Biography
| Language(s) Spoken |
|---|
| English |
| Education |
|---|
| Medical School: MD, University of Mississippi School of Medicine (1986) |
| Medical School: University of Mississippi School of Medicine (1986) |
| Internship: General Surgery, Baylor University Medical Center (1988) |
| Residency: Urology, University of Mississippi Med Ctr School of Med (1991) |
| Residency: Urology, University of Mississippi Med Ctr School of Med (1991) |
| Fellowship: Reconstructive Urology, Eastern Virginia Medical School (1992) |

Patients appreciate
Dr. Charles Secrest consistently receives exceptional praise for his clinical expertise, interpersonal skills, and patient-centered approach. Patients repeatedly describe him as highly knowledgeable, experienced, and skilled in his field, with many stating he is "the best" and noting that people travel from across the country to see him. His bedside manner stands out as a major strength, with reviewers emphasizing that he is caring, compassionate, kind, and personable. Patients appreciate that he takes time to listen carefully to their concerns, explains procedures and conditions thoroughly in understandable terms, never rushes appointments, and makes them feel comfortable discussing sensitive issues. Many note his professionalism combined with a warm, friendly demeanor that makes patients feel valued rather than just "the next in line." His staff also receives consistent praise for being helpful, courteous, and professional.
Patients also share
Wait times emerge as the primary concern across multiple reviews. Several patients report waiting 45 to 75 minutes or longer beyond their scheduled appointment times, with one patient noting they arrived 30 minutes early for a 1:00 PM appointment but didn't see Dr. Secrest until 2:44 PM. While patients acknowledge he is very busy and understand that unexpected issues arise, some express frustration about the lack of communication regarding delays. One review mentions that Dr. Secrest has excellent skills but does not follow up after surgery. A single review describes him as having a "horrible bedside manner" and being prone to "fuss and question" during procedures, though this stands in stark contrast to the overwhelming majority of feedback praising his interpersonal approach.
